Output 60528cf88c65586b8d16f24c00bd136ef0bc7c07cf113194ffe7a3111feb2e4e:1

value
26298545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3d2e872fd6f8c321c7a7e52872d6e0d58dfdf05 OP_EQUAL
address
3PvEnJZbgVhw5GWZRtHqMMEX46fyWAdERd
transaction
60528cf88c65586b8d16f24c00bd136ef0bc7c07cf113194ffe7a3111feb2e4e
spent
true